On the first day we met with retired Israeli Lt. Col. Eran Masas.  On October 7, 2023, the day of the massacre, he received news of a possible attack near Gaza and felt compelled to grab his personal weapon and old uniform and drive south for hours from Haifa, despite having no orders or authorization to do so.  After encountering and eliminating two terrorists, Eran was one of the first IDF representatives to see the Nova Festival Massacre.  He described the horrific scene, how the terrorists savagely mutilated and burned many of the victims, and his efforts to give the bodies some dignity.  Here is a link to his interview with ABC News -  https://abcnews.go.com/International/video/israeli-responder-recounts-searching-life-after-music-festival-104742506

We then met with Chen Kolter Abrahams at Kibbutz Kfar Aza, which we also toured.  She explained how the terrorists, through the many Palestinians that came from Gaza each day to work at the kibbutzim (basically Israel communal farms where people live and work), knew the locations of each kibbutz’s weapons.  The terrorists immediately secured the weapons when they entered a kibbutz.  When the attack started, the terrorists simultaneously attacked the police station and military base.  Therefore, the terrorists were free to rape and kill for hours.  At this kibbutz, the killing lasted all day.  She spoke about the devastation they and so many others experienced, and how two of their young men, residents of the kibbutz she has known from birth, are still among the hostages.  Here is a podcast interview with her - https://open.spotify.com/episode/6TRrmKeYulakhUV9nuP9xD?si=877590a4f5ac42b1&nd=1&dlsi=b31d8b69fb454119

Afterwards we went to the site of the Nova Massacre, where we met with survivor Rafaela Treistman.  When the bombs started falling, she made it, with dozens of others, into a bomb shelter.  In the hours that followed, the terrorists pumped gas, threw grenades, and shot into the shelter.  She was one of only a few survivors, remaining hidden under dead bodies for hours.  Here is a link to an interview with her - https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=wYy24H0W6Jc

The following day we went to the Israel Antiquities Authority, which is set to open a major guest experience next year.  We met with Chief Development Officer Sagi Melamed and Dr. Joe Uziel, head of the Dead Sea Scrolls Unit.  We saw some of the Dead Sea Scrolls and other artifacts which demonstrate the Jewish history in the land.  We saw portions of Genesis, Psalms 133, and the oldest known writing of the Ten Commandments, all of these over 2,000 years old. 

The Palestinians have a major disinformation campaign, and they often produce maps without any depiction of Israel (for that is the goal of Hamas and the other radical Muslim leaders).  They also deny Jewish history in the land as a way to fight against Jewish claims and settlements.  But all they do is lie.  The archaeological records prove the Jewish presence in the land for thousands of years, centuries (and more) before Islam even existed.

We also learned how archeologists played a key role in identifying victims of the October 7 Massacre.  The terrorists used a special concoction to completely burn many of the victims beyond any identifying features.  Through cutting edge archeological techniques, scientists were able to identify a number of the victims and at least bring some closure to their grieving families.

The following day we toured the National Leadership Center (the “NLC”) (https://jhisrael.com/nlc) in Ariel, Israel.  Mrs. Johnston worked with former Ariel Mayor Ron Nachman (now deceased) to start the NLC.  The NLC hosts numerous groups of Israeli soldiers and students, helping them learn, grow and heal, with fun and physical programs which also teach the participants their Biblical heritage.  

While there we met with the mayor of Ariel, Ya’ir Chetboun, who was a school principal when he first began bringing children to the NLC.  We also met with Ruth Knoller Levy from the Israel Ministry of Education.  We learned about the powerful impact the NLC is having on the nation of Israel, especially with their educational programs, to help the Israeli people understand their Biblical heritage and claim to the Promised Land.  Perhaps most movingly, we learned about the NLC’s programs for orphans and returning soldiers.  The programs at the NLC help them heal from the traumas experienced, connect with surviving family members, and move forward in good lives with G_d’s help.

We then toured the site of the Jerusalem Leadership Institute, which is immediately adjacent to Mount Herzl, a national cemetery and memorial location in Jerusalem.  The Jerusalem Leadership Institute is the next extension of the NLC, and the land for the Jerusalem Leadership Institute has been leased from the Israeli government for five years.  Renovations are underway with operations set to begin next month.  At the Jerusalem Leadership Institute, the significant works of educating the children, helping the soldiers, and supporting the nation of Israel will continue.  The Jerusalem Leadership Institute includes hotel rooms, meeting spaces, and outdoor activities, all of which will help with the educational and healing efforts for the troops and students.  There will also be a special focus on parent and child retreats, bringing families closer together even amidst the regional conflicts.  This miraculous opportunity in Jerusalem will take all these efforts to the next level, and G_d is going to do amazing things for His people there.
